The Ministry of Finance, Department of Revenue, issued Notification No. 05/2024-Customs (ADD) on March 14, 2024, concerning the review of anti-dumping duty on imports of Ethylene Vinyl Acetate (EVA) Sheet for Solar Module from China PR. - The authority recommended the continuation of anti-dumping duty to alleviate injury to the domestic industry. - In exercise of its powers, the Central Government imposed anti-dumping duty on the specified goods originating from China PR, with varying rates depending on the producer, to be levied for a period of five years, unless revoked, superseded, or amended earlier.
